It looks like Korg could be preparing to launch a successor to its popular microKORG mini synth. Videos have appeared on the internet that appear to show a new keyboard called the microKORG XL.

As with its predecessor, the device features mini rather than full-size keys, and the presence of a microphone indicates that the vocoder has been retained. The synth looks to have a decidedly retro design, and there seem to be fewer controls than you'll find on the original microKORG.

Korg has yet to reveal spec details of the XL - though it has confirmed to MusicRadar that the new synth is on the way - but we suspect that it could be one of the products that the company launches at the 2009 Winter NAMM show in January.
